Frog on the Moon
Stephanie Pressman started writing poetry at
about age nine and finished a romantic novelette at thirteen. She has written
poetry through college; while teaching high school; in between raising kids,
getting an MA in English at San Jose State University, and teaching writing
at
the community college level; and during her career as graphic artist and owner
of her own design and publishing business. She is currently retired and lives
in Cupertino, California, with her husband, various adult offspring and six or
so cats. Her work has appeared in Montserrat
Review, cæsura, Bridges, CQ/California State Poetry Quarterly, The MacGuffin, The Kerf, and other small press magazines.
As a graphic designer for over 25 years, she
has created a great variety of materials including logos, collateral, corporate
brochures,
packaging, menus, and posters, mostly things that could be printed.
She designed covers and/or layouts of several poetry books for the small
publishing company, Jacaranda Press, for americas review, and for Poetry San José’s
semi-annual journal, cæsura.
